A chaotic lifestyle is characterized by a state of disorder and unpredictability in daily activities, routines, and responsibilities. Individuals with a chaotic lifestyle often experience a lack of structure, frequent disruptions, and difficulty managing time and tasks effectively. This can lead to increased stress, diminished productivity, and negative impacts on mental and physical health. The causes of a chaotic lifestyle can vary widely. Personal factors, such as difficulty with time management, poor organizational skills, or a tendency to procrastinate, can contribute to a disordered daily routine. External factors, such as a demanding work schedule, family responsibilities, or financial pressures, can exacerbate the sense of chaos. Life changes or crises, such as moving to a new city, experiencing a relationship breakdown, or dealing with health issues, can also disrupt routines and create a sense of instability. Additionally, mental health conditions like anxiety or att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) can contribute to difficulties in maintaining a structured lifestyle.
Treatment for a chaotic lifestyle involves implementing strategies to bring more order and stability to daily life. Establishing a structured routine with set schedules for work, exercise, and leisure activities can help create a sense of predictability. Time management techniques, such as setting priorities, breaking tasks into smaller steps, and using organizational tools like planners or apps, can improve efficiency and reduce stress. Addressing underlying issues, such as mental health conditions or life stressors, with the help of a therapist or counselor can also be beneficial. Developing healthy habits, such as regular sleep patterns, balanced nutrition, and stress management techniques, can support overall well-being and help maintain a more organized lifestyle. Regular self-assessment and adjustments to routines may be necessary to sustain long-term improvements and achieve a balanced and manageable daily life.
